JURASSIC -Upper Jurassic, Tithonian (145.0–152.1 million years) - Germany
Very rare and decorative coral fish of the genus Propterus microstomus from the world famous Solnhofen Plattenkalk.
The Propterus has a length of 8.8 cm and is on a 39.5 cm x 31 cm large, unbroken matrix. Professional preparation.
The fossil comes from an old collection. The location is the Plattenkalk quarry Wintershof near Eichstätt (Altmühltal, Bavaria, Germany).
